5SMG

PanDDA analysis group deposition -- Crystal Structure of SARS-CoV-2 NSP14 in complex with Z2092370954

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sDIAMOND BEAMLINE I04-1
Synchrotron siteDiamond
BeamlineI04-1
Temperature [K]100
Detector technologyPIXEL
Collection date2022-02-03
DetectorDECTRIS PILATUS 6M
Wavelength(s)0.91788
Spacegroup nameP 21 21 21
Unit cell lengths67.422, 68.042, 138.544
Unit cell angles90.00, 90.00, 90.00
